Botox
Botox is a popular choice for those wanting to minimize wrinkles and fine lines around the eyes and forehead. It works by paralyzing muscle contractions, which helps to reduce the appearance of dynamic wrinkles. Botox treatments are minimally invasive and can provide results that last for several months, making it a convenient option for busy schedules.
Chemical Peels
Chemical peels involve applying a chemical solution to the skin to promote cell turnover and reveal fresher, smoother skin beneath. There are different types of chemical peels, each targeting different skin concerns such as sun damage, acne, and fine lines. The process can be done in-office and often requires a series of treatments to achieve optimal results. Chemical peels can dramatically improve skin texture and enhance the overall appearance.
Micro-needling
Micro-needling, also known as collagen induction therapy, involves using tiny needles to puncture the skin and stimulate the production of collagen. This procedure can help with issues such as acne scarring, fine lines, and uneven skin texture. Micro-needling often requires multiple sessions for best results and can be performed in a medical office setting. It is an effective non-surgical alternative to more invasive treatments like facelifts.

Facelifts
For those seeking more drastic results, a facelift is a surgical option that can effectively smooth out deep wrinkles, lift sagging skin, and restore a youthful appearance. Facelifts involve a surgical procedure that repositions the underlying tissue, pulls it tight, and often removes excess skin. This procedure is typically more extensive than other options and might be paired with other procedures such as forehead lifts or brow lifts for a more holistic approach.
